According to experts offering ankle Arthroscopy in Naperville a podiatrist is a medical professional who specializes in treating problems related to the feet ankles and lower legs. They are well trained to diagnose and treat a huge range of conditions from common issues like bunions and plantar fasciitis to more serious problems like diabetic foot care. you can think of them as the go to experts anything that impacts how you stand walk or move from the knees down. According to experts offering fractures Treatment in plainfield fracture is a medical word for a broken bone. Sometimes the bone cracks a little and sometimes it breaks into two or more pieces depending on how bad the break is treatment can be simple or might even need surgery.
